Save energy, and keep your house secure

Smart lights can help you save energy, and also keep your house more secure. If you've got your lights automatically coming on at sunset, then you should also set up a routine to make sure they turn off later on at night. Not only does this save energy, but lights left on all night for more than one night is a clear sign that the house is unoccupied. The simplest way to do this is to set a regular routine that turns off all lights at a particular time at night. If you have sensors in your smart home network, you can also use them for a more sophisticated solution.

To do this in Alexa, create a new routine, and in the "When" section, you can choose a specific time. You can then add the action to turn off all your lights.

In the Smart Life app, in the "Smart" menu, choose "Automation", and add a new routine with the blue cross. Select "Schedule", and you can choose the time, and the set the action to turn off all your lights.
